Revenue can be divided into operating revenue—sales from a company’s core business—and non-operating revenue which is derived from secondary sources. As these non-operating revenue sources are often unpredictable or nonrecurring, they can be referred to as one-time events or gains. For example, proceeds from the sale of an asset, a windfall from investments, or money awarded through litigation are non-operating revenue. Both 1099 workers and W-2 employees must pay FICA taxes for Social Security activity method of depreciation example limitation and Medicare. But, whereas W-2 employees split the combined FICA tax rate of 15.3% with their employers, 1099 workers are responsible for the entire amount. Tax credits directly reduce the amount of tax you owe, dollar for dollar. A tax credit valued at $1,000, for instance, lowers your tax bill by $1,000.

The FICA rate due every pay period is 15.3% of an employee’s wages. However, this tax payment is divided in half between the employer and the employee. Presumably, your equations for demand and supply are before tax. We assume the units of $P$ and $Q$ are cartons, though this seems incongruous with the scale of the equations. Now the demand equation doesn’t change, but the supply equation should have $P$ replaced by $P-20$ as the producer gets that much less revenue from the selling price.
